117.info
人生若只如初见

django数据库增删改查的方法是什么

Django是一个开发Web应用程序的框架,它提供了一种简单而强大的方式来进行数据库的增删改查操作。以下是Django中常用的数据库操作方法:

  1. 查询数据:
  • 使用模型类的objects属性进行查询,如:Model.objects.all()获取所有数据,Model.objects.get()获取单个数据,Model.objects.filter()进行筛选查询等。
  1. 插入数据:
  • 创建一个模型类的实例对象,设置属性值,然后调用save()方法保存到数据库中。
  1. 修改数据:
  • 通过查询操作获取到需要修改的数据对象,然后修改其属性值,再调用save()方法保存到数据库中。
  1. 删除数据:
  • 通过查询操作获取到需要删除的数据对象,然后调用delete()方法删除该对象。

以上是Django中常用的数据库操作方法,可以根据具体的需求使用适当的方法进行操作。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e40eAzsLBAVVAVU.html

推荐文章

  • django怎么获取文本框值更新数据库

    要获取文本框的值并更新数据库,你可以按照以下步骤进行操作: 在Django中创建一个包含文本框的HTML表单,例如: {% csrf_token %} 更新 在urls.py中定义一个路由...

  • django怎么批量更新数据库

    在Django中,可以使用update()方法对数据库进行批量更新操作。以下是一个示例:
    假设有一个名为Book的模型,该模型有一个字段price代表书籍的价格。现在要将...

  • django怎么获取已有数据库的数据

    在Django中,你可以使用模型(Model)来获取已有数据库的数据。
    首先,确保你已经创建了一个Django项目,并且已经配置好了数据库连接。
    接下来,你需要...

  • django怎么调用数据库数据

    在Django中,你可以使用以下几种方式来调用数据库数据: 使用ORM(对象关系映射):Django提供了一个高层次的ORM,可以直接通过Python代码来操作数据库,而不需要...

  • ASP.NET UniqueID属性的作用是什么

    ASP.NET UniqueID属性是用于在Web应用程序中标识控件的唯一ID。它生成一个唯一的字符串,用于在服务器端标识控件。在页面上,控件的UniqueID由其容器的UniqueID和...

  • php implode函数的用法是什么

    implode 函数是 PHP 中的一个字符串处理函数,用于将数组元素连接成一个字符串。implode 函数的用法如下:
    string implode ( string $glue , array $pieces...

  • CSS background-image属性有什么用

    CSS background-image属性用于设置元素的背景图片。
    具体用途如下: 设置背景图片:通过指定URL值,可以将图像作为元素的背景显示。 设置多个背景图像:通过...

  • HTML DOM innerHTML属性有什么用

    innerHTML属性用于获取或设置HTML元素的内容。它可以用于读取元素的内容,也可以用于修改元素的内容。
    用法示例: 获取元素的内容: var element = documen...